Add Wood Grain Texture To 3D Prints – With A Model Of A Log

June 3, 2025 by Donald Papp 35 Comments

Adding textures is a great way to experiment with giving 3D prints a different look, and [PandaN] shows off a method of adding a wood grain effect in a way that’s easy to play around with. It involves using a 3D model of a log (complete with concentric tree rings) as a print modifier. The good news is that [PandaN] has already done the work of creating one, as well as showing how to use it.
